+/* In MPC8641HPCN, we allocate 16MB flash spaces at fe000000 and ff000000
+ * We only have an 8MB flash. In effect, the addresses from fe000000 to fe7fffff
+ * map to fe800000 to ffffffff, and ff000000 to ff7fffff map to ffffffff.
+ * However, when u-boot comes up, the flash_init needs hard start addresses
+ * to build its info table. For user convenience, we have the flash addresses
+ * as fe800000 and ff800000. That way, when we do flash operations, u-boot
+ * knows where the flash is and the user can download u-boot code from promjet to
+ * fef00000 <- more intuitive than fe700000. Note that, on switching the boot
+ * location, fef00000 becomes fff00000.
+*/
+#define CFG_FLASH_BASE          0xfe800000     /* start of FLASH 32M */
+#define CFG_FLASH_BASE2		0xff800000	
+
+#define CFG_FLASH_BANKS_LIST {CFG_FLASH_BASE, CFG_FLASH_BASE2}

+/* BAT0         2G     Cacheable, non-guarded
+ * 0x0000_0000  2G     DDR
+ */
+//#define CFG_DBAT0L      (0x0 | BATL_PP_RW | BATL_MEMCOHERENCE)
+#define CFG_DBAT0L      (0x0 |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E | BATL_MEMCOHERENCE)
+#define CFG_DBAT0U      (0x0 | BATU_BL_512M | BATU_VS | BATU_VP)
+//#define CFG_IBAT0L      CFG_DBAT0L
+//#define CFG_IBAT0L      (0x0 | BATL_PP_RW | BATL_CACHEINHIBIT)
+#define CFG_IBAT0L      (0x0| BATL_PP_RW | BATL_CACHEINHIBIT | BATL_MEMCOHERENCE)
+#define CFG_IBAT0U      CFG_DBAT0U
+
+/* BAT1         1G     Cache-inhibited, guarded
+ * 0x8000_0000  512M   PCI-Express 1 Memory
+ * 0xa000_0000  512M   PCI-Express 2 Memory
+ ** SS - Changed it for operating from 0xd0000000
+ */
+#define CFG_DBAT1L      (CFG_PCI1_MEM_BASE |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E)
+#define CFG_DBAT1U      (CFG_PCI1_MEM_BASE | BATU_BL_256M | BATU_VS | BATU_VP)
+#define CFG_IBAT1L      (CFG_PCI1_MEM_BASE | BATL_PP_RW | BATL_CACHEINHIBIT)
+#define CFG_IBAT1U      CFG_DBAT1U
+
+/* BAT2         512M   Cache-inhibited, guarded
+ * 0xc000_0000  512M   RapidIO Memory
+ */
+#define CFG_DBAT2L      (CFG_RIO_MEM_BASE |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E)
+#define CFG_DBAT2U      (CFG_RIO_MEM_BASE | BATU_BL_512M | BATU_VS | BATU_VP)
+#define CFG_IBAT2L      (CFG_RIO_MEM_BASE | BATL_PP_RW | BATL_CACHEINHIBIT)
+#define CFG_IBAT2U      CFG_DBAT2U
+
+/* BAT3         4M     Cache-inhibited, guarded
+ * 0xf800_0000  4M     CCSR
+ */
+#define CFG_DBAT3L      (CFG_CCSRBAR |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E)
+#define CFG_DBAT3U      (CFG_CCSRBAR | BATU_BL_4M | BATU_VS | BATU_VP)
+#define CFG_IBAT3L      (CFG_CCSRBAR | BATL_PP_RW | BATL_CACHEINHIBIT)
+#define CFG_IBAT3U      CFG_DBAT3U
+
+/* BAT4         32M    Cache-inhibited, guarded
+ * 0xe200_0000  16M    PCI-Express 1 I/O
+ * 0xe300_0000  16M    PCI-Express 2 I/0
+ ** SS - Note that this is at 0xe0000000
+ */
+#define CFG_DBAT4L      (CFG_PCI1_IO_BASE |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E)
+#define CFG_DBAT4U      (CFG_PCI1_IO_BASE | BATU_BL_32M | BATU_VS | BATU_VP)
+#define CFG_IBAT4L      (CFG_PCI1_IO_BASE | BATL_PP_RW | BATL_CACHEINHIBIT)
+#define CFG_IBAT4U      CFG_DBAT4U
+
+/* BAT5         128K   Cacheable, non-guarded
+ * 0xe401_0000  128K   Init RAM for stack in the CPU DCache (no backing memory)
+ */
+#define CFG_DBAT5L      (CFG_INIT_RAM_ADDR | BATL_PP_RW | BATL_MEMCOHERENCE)
+#define CFG_DBAT5U      (CFG_INIT_RAM_ADDR | BATU_BL_128K | BATU_VS | BATU_VP)
+#define CFG_IBAT5L      CFG_DBAT5L
+#define CFG_IBAT5U      CFG_DBAT5U
+
+/* BAT6         32M    Cache-inhibited, guarded
+ * 0xfe00_0000  32M    FLASH
+ */
+#define CFG_DBAT6L      (CFG_FLASH_BASE | BATL_PP_RW | BATL_CACHEINHIBIT | BATL_GUARDEDSTORAGE)
+#define CFG_DBAT6U      (CFG_FLASH_BASE | BATU_BL_32M | BATU_VS | BATU_VP)
+#define CFG_IBAT6L      (CFG_FLASH_BASE | BATL_PP_RW | BATL_MEMCOHERENCE)
+#define CFG_IBAT6U      CFG_DBAT6U
